Long Time, No See...

...A walkoff blast from Big Papi, that is! It's been almost two years, the last one coming in September of '07. Tonight, in a game that marked Wake's return to the rotation, and a very strong return at that, Papi broke a 2-all tie in the bottom of the ninth by taking a Tony Pena pitch high and deep into the right field seats. The patented Papi walkoff magic was actually his second long ball of the night. The first one came in the second inning, tying the game at one.

Wake and V-Mart, the other big story of the game: Wake went 7 innings, allowing 1 run, walking 1, and fanning 3. V-Mart, who had never caught a knuckler in a game situation before, did a fabulous job, with the only ball eluding his glove coming in the first inning with no-one on base. He embraced the challenge of catching the most unpredictable pitch known to man and came out on top. It's great to see Wake have such a strong outing after over a month on the DL; it's as if he never left. If he can keep it up, with V-Mart behind the plate, that's great news for the Red Sox.
